I have always loved the idea of meditation, I do however struggle to stay focused. One of two things usually happen.

  1. My mind will flood with unrelated thoughts.

  2. I fall asleep.

I hear these are quite common things and to keep trying but I thought I would give you an example of what happened to me the other night when I was listening to a guided meditation.

It was 8pm, I went to bed early to master meditation #igotthis.

I got ready, lay down, put on a meditation and closed my eyes. I'm not gonna lie, this meditation was doing a bit of the opposite of what it was supposed to. I felt agitated by the woman's voice and must have hit my phone and in the process I changed the speed to 1.5x so she was talking ridiculously fast and it became more agitating, I leaned over to flick on my lamp and get my glasses and managed to knock over a full glass of water. The water spilt over 2 novels, a magazine, a journal, a watch, my phone, two walls and the floor. It was carnage and stress levels were the opposite of what was intended.

It took me a while to get myself sorted and needless to say that was the end of that for the evening. Instead I researched a bit after texting a friend about my debacle.
